The Association for the Study of Ethnicity and Nationalism (ASEN) is an interdisciplinary student-led research association founded by research students and academics in 1990 at the London School of Economics & Political Science.

ASEN seeks to fulfil two broad objectives:

  • To facilitate and maintain an interdisciplinary, global network of researchers, academics and other scholars interested in ethnicity and nationalism; and
  • To stimulate, produce, and diffuse world-class research on ethnicity and nationalism.
